Thomas Markle, the estranged father of Meghan, Duchess of Sussex, marked his 81st birthday on Friday in quiet solitude, reportedly without any communication from his daughter or contact with his grandchildren. According to Express UK, the milestone birthday was “full of mixed emotions” for the retired Hollywood lighting director, who has spent years publicly pleading for reconciliation with Meghan.
Despite his repeated appeals, the rift between them remains unresolved, and Markle has yet to meet his grandchildren, Prince Archie and Princess Lilibet, whom Meghan shares with Prince Harry. While Meghan and her circle offered no public acknowledgment of the occasion, some royal fans, especially supporters of Prince William and Princess Kate, took to social media to wish Thomas a happy birthday.
Many of those messages praised him for previously speaking out against Meghan, underscoring the persistent divides among royal watchers and the ongoing polarization surrounding the Sussexes. The estrangement between Thomas and Meghan dates back to 2018, in the lead-up to her wedding to Prince Harry.

At the time, Thomas was caught staging paparazzi photos of himself preparing for royal life—reading books about British culture and being fitted for a suit. The images triggered a media storm and reportedly embarrassed the royal family, further widening the gap between father and daughter.
Adding to the intrigue, Meghan posted a cryptic message on Instagram just days before her father’s birthday. While the post didn’t directly address Thomas or the occasion, it fueled speculation online about the state of their relationship and whether any reconciliation could be on the horizon.

To date, Meghan has not publicly commented on the possibility of reconnecting with her father, and Thomas continues to express regret and hope for a reunion. The silence from Meghan on such a significant personal day for her father suggests the wounds between them remain deep.
Whether the two will ever rebuild their relationship remains uncertain. But for now, Thomas Markle’s 81st birthday passes as another reminder of a family bond left unrepaired—one marked more by public statements than private conversations.
